Hey guys, I have a teenage mutant ninja turtles pcb that is fully working but the sound seems a bit funny. It also appears to be missing one of the dip switch boxes on the board. Its missing the small one on the right. The game itself plays fine, but the music seems weird which is why I'm selling it for 55 shipped. When you first power the game on, you dont hear the tmnt theme song, which may be a dip switch setting, but I am not sure. Feel free to ask any questions, thanks! -Jason
 
When you first power the game on, you dont hear the tmnt theme song, which may be a dip switch setting, but I am not sure


This is a dip switch setting in bank 2, switch 8. On = attract sound, off = none.
If you are missing the small dip switch bank, that one controls video flip and test mode.

I've seen other turtles boards that do that exact same thing, it may not be a big deal, I've just never tried to fix one.

Also a new dipswitch is easy to install, it's like a dollar. You could steal one off a parts board too if you bought this one.

I'm surprised nobody's came up with a guide how to fix these sound issues, they're pretty common on turtles boards, and I don't think it's a huge problem that can't be repaired, or something as bad as the X-men problems.
 
I know it's sold but figured I would mention that TMNT was a mono game... The cab has only one speaker (I gots one).

Simpsons and others seemed to be stereo.
